XDS/CDS Object Types

Following is a list of all the object types that are described in the following subtopics. Most of these objects are object structures; that is, compounds consisting of superobjects that contain subobjects as some of their values. These latter may in turn contain other objects, and so on. Subobjects are indicated by indentation. A DS_C_DS_DN object contains at least one DS_C_DS_RDN object, and each of the latter contains one DS_C_AVA object. Note that subobjects can, and often do, exist by themselves, depending on what object class is called for by a given function. This list contains all the possible kinds of objects that can be required as input for any XDS/CDS operation.

· DS_C_ATTRIBUTE_LIST

- DS_C_ATTRIBUTE

· DS_C_DS_DN

- DS_C_DS_RDN

- DS_C_AVA

· DS_C_ENTRY_MOD_LIST

- DS_C_ENTRY_MOD

· DS_C_ENTRY_INFO_SELECTION
